defmodule DocxTmpl do @moduledoc """ Make new `.docx` files from a Handlebars-like template. ## Template syntax Hello {{name}}, welcome to {{company}}. {{#each items}}- {{name}} × {{qty}} {{/each}} {{#if paid}}Thanks!{{/if}} {{#unless paid}}Please pay.{{/unless}} `{{#each}}` wrapping a single `` repeats the table row. `{{image var}}` standalone in a paragraph embeds an image. The assigns value is `%{bytes: binary, format: :png | :jpeg | :gif, width_cm: number, height_cm: number}`. Missing values drop the paragraph. ## Why DOCX is tricky Word frequently splits a single placeholder like `{{name}}` across multiple `` runs (different fonts, spellcheck markers, revisions). Before substitution we run a *smart-merge* pass that stitches such fragmented placeholders back together. See `DocxTmpl.SmartMerge`. ## Public API * `render/2`, `render!/2` — render an in-memory `.docx` binary. * `render_file/3`, `render_file!/3` — convenience wrappers for paths. Everything under `DocxTmpl.*` other than this module is internal and may change without notice. """ alias DocxTmpl.{Parser, Render, SmartMerge, Structural, Zip} @type assigns :: map() @type docx_binary :: binary() @doc """ Render `template` (raw `.docx` bytes) with `assigns`. """ @spec render(docx_binary(), assigns()) :: {:ok, docx_binary()} | {:error, term()} def render(template, assigns) when is_binary(template) and is_map(assigns) do Render.run(template, assigns) end @doc "Raising variant of `render/2`." @spec render!(docx_binary(), assigns()) :: docx_binary() def render!(template, assigns) do case render(template, assigns) do {:ok, bin} -> bin {:error, reason} -> raise ArgumentError, "docx render failed: #{inspect(reason)}" end end @doc "Read a `.docx` from disk, render it, return the new bytes." @spec render_file(Path.t(), assigns(), keyword()) :: {:ok, docx_binary()} | {:error, term()} def render_file(path, assigns, _opts \\ []) do with {:ok, bin} <- File.read(path) do render(bin, assigns) end end @doc """ List every variable name referenced by `template`. Returns a sorted, deduplicated list of identifiers used in `{{var}}`, `{{#if x}}`, `{{#unless x}}`, and `{{#each x}}` tags — including names referenced inside block bodies. Dotted paths (`a.b`) are returned as-is. Roles (interpolation vs. condition vs. iteration) are intentionally not distinguished here; callers that need that should parse the template themselves. """ @spec variables(docx_binary()) :: {:ok, [String.t()]} | {:error, term()} def variables(template) when is_binary(template) do with {:ok, entries} <- Zip.unpack(template) do names = for {name, bin} <- entries, Zip.template_part?(name), reduce: MapSet.new() do acc -> bin |> SmartMerge.heal() |> Structural.fixup() |> Parser.parse() |> collect_names(acc) end {:ok, names |> MapSet.to_list() |> Enum.sort()} end end defp collect_names(nodes, acc) when is_list(nodes) do Enum.reduce(nodes, acc, &collect_names/2) end defp collect_names({:text, _}, acc), do: acc defp collect_names({:var, p}, acc), do: MapSet.put(acc, p) defp collect_names({kind, p, children}, acc) when kind in [:if, :unless, :each] do collect_names(children, MapSet.put(acc, p)) end @doc "Raising variant of `render_file/3`." @spec render_file!(Path.t(), assigns(), keyword()) :: docx_binary() def render_file!(path, assigns, opts \\ []) do case render_file(path, assigns, opts) do {:ok, bin} -> bin {:error, reason} -> raise ArgumentError, "docx render failed: #{inspect(reason)}" end end end
